Yeah, and I saw, what was it, 111, 112? I saw somebody said 114. But it's up from $70 before this whole thing began. Right. Now, it depends on what kind of oil you're talking about. If it's Brent crude, that's the expensive stuff. That is about $115 a barrel. WTI, the West Texas oil, that's closer to $97 a barrel. The difference is you can refine them into different products. WTI is more common. Brent is the sweet stuff, though, that is easier to ship. So, yeah, you sort of have to look at both numbers, but still, stuff. is higher because look at what's on TV.
